The Nome Airport ( IATA: OME; ICAO: PAOM ) is operated by the state, publicly-used airport, which is located 2 km west from the city center Nomes.

According to the FAA, the airport recorded 56 658 passengers.

The state of Alaska also operates the Nome City Field north of town.

History

During World War II, the airport was used as a military base. Under the name of Marks Army Airfield used the civilian and military airport the same infrastructure.

"Airport Pizza "

Near the airport there is a pizzeria which "Airport Pizza " is. It is known that it provides using the Bering Air Pizza in distant settlements.
